Finding GCD of 238, 363, 195, 885 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 238, 363, 195, 885

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 238 is 2 x 7 x 17

Prime Factorization of 363 is 3 x 11 x 11

Prime Factorization of 195 is 3 x 5 x 13

Prime Factorization of 885 is 3 x 5 x 59

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
